Anton Oilfield Services Group EBIT Calculation

EBIT, sometimes also called Earnings Before Interest and Taxes, is a measure of a firm's profit that includes all expenses except interest and income tax expenses. It is the difference between operating revenues and operating expenses. When a firm does not have non-operating income, then Operating Income is sometimes used as a synonym for EBIT and operating profit.

Anton Oilfield Services Group  (FRA:5AO) EBIT Explanation

1. EBIT or Operating Income is linked to Return on Capital for both regular definition and Joel Greenblatt's definition.

Anton Oilfield Services Group's annualized ROC %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

ROC % (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=NOPAT/Average Invested Capital
=Operating Income * ( 1 - Tax Rate % )/( (Invested Capital (Q: Jun. 2023 ) + Invested Capital (Q: Dec. 2023 ))/ count )
=106.046 * ( 1 - 45.49% )/( (712.588 + 739.468)/ 2 )
=57.8056746/726.028
=7.96 %

where

Invested Capital(Q: Jun. 2023 )
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- Excess Cash
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- (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ities - max(0, Total Current Liabilities - Total Current Assets+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ities))
=1172.662 - 309.576 - ( 150.498 - max(0, 605.186 - 792.514+150.498))
=712.588

Invested Capital(Q: Dec. 2023 )
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- Excess Cash
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- (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ities - max(0, Total Current Liabilities - Total Current Assets+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ities))
=1259.475 - 316.335 - ( 203.672 - max(0, 670.477 - 902.017+203.672))
=739.468

Note: The Operating Income data used here is two times the semi-annual (Dec. 2023) data.

Anton Oilfield Services Group Business Description

Anton Oilfield Services Group is an investment holding company principally engaged in the provision of integrated oil and gas field development technical services. The Company operates its business through three segments. The Drilling Technology segment is engaged in the provision of engineering technical services and products to solve problems encountered in directional drilling, drilling assessment and enhanced reservoir contact and integrated drilling. The Well Completion segment is engaged in integrated well completion and stimulation services from integrated solutions for well completion, production, equipment, tools, and materials. The Oil Production Services segment is engaged in enabling economic recovery based on reservoir geological conditions.
